Default How do i install a SUB on a NON-BOSE concert radio?..................more

I read the tech article and I do not like that setup where you splice the wires, and would not recommend running power wires through your ECU either. But I just ordered an AMP and SUB from Crutchfield, but do not know how to install it. Please help all you audiphiles!!! THANKS. How has everyone else installed there subs? I ordered one 12" sub for the trunk.

Default you can get wire taps from any automotive parts store.

they are nice and neat and are fairly clean looking.

personally I did run the power wire thru the ECU box. i regret it even though i have not yet experienced any problems related to this.

get a coat hangar and use elec. tape to attach some speaker wire to the end. then drill your hole for the power wire, put in a grommet, and use the hangar to snake the cables through.

as for tapping into the sound, you're either gonna have to use wire taps, or you need to make an adaptor for the factory harness at the back of the radio.

Default OK, what i did:

i went to Audi parts and ordered the wiring harness housing for the back of the radio.
then i went to 4 other dealerships looking for the gold-plated wire connectors that they're not supposed to sell me.

i got some high-quality RCA connectors and wire, and wired them into the housing (twice, be careful to make your adaptor flexible, or you'll ruin it when you try to put it in the car)

so now, i have the LINE OUT pins on the back of the radio feeding a sony 505 crossover (>$300). it allows me to connect (via RCA cables) amplifiers and give me control of:

subwoofer volume & crossover point
independant front and rear levels
hi-pass frequency

to boot, it also serves as a pre amp (boosting the volume a bit)
and the fader **** on the deck still work.

it would be alot easier if audi put RCA plugs on the back of their radios.
